product review: Tamanu E cellular regeneration creme

Product experience:
I use it on my acne that is popping out and any discoloration that I have at night. Since this product has tamanu oil, it has the same weird smell. I realised I couldn't use this in the morning fearing people at work might smell it on me and the product does not cont. It's a great creme product that is easily absorbed by my skin. I also use this product on any minor irritations that I have.

What really is African black soap? There is a lot of misconception about what black soap is. This product is so effective that there are even companies racking up on millions of dollars selling fake black soap- neatly shaped, hard bars dyed black. Black soap comes in a few shades, from very black to brown. The base of the soap- ashes of plaintain and cocoa pods, determines the final color. Lighter brown versions often use less of the ashes. Tammie sources her black soap from the Yoruba tribe in Nigeria who are believed to have been the original makers of this black soap. Believed to be descendants from Egypt, the Yorubans carried their knowledge of herbal medicine westward. They developed black soap to cleanse the skin from harmful parasites, etc. Today they still cook it up in traditional manner by first creating the ash and then cooking the ash with oils such as shea butter to form the final product.
